Output 6767e05aa715f58a139082121f6f0cc8258a53bdeedcee0fa5371388f5525d3e:3

value
594664850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f1fdcf6733f6b6177818801dae45340db39e77f OP_EQUAL
address
34Xb3NzTWdEw8rAWTXApAjgvCYLwp7i79P
transaction
6767e05aa715f58a139082121f6f0cc8258a53bdeedcee0fa5371388f5525d3e
spent
true